  • A question for Matthias:
    Did Hanka Pachale play for German NT apart from OGQ in Halle? If not do you know why? Cos Germany always needed a good OH like her and from the stats we can clearly see she was pretty good in Serie A but I can't see her name in any of the major competitions, OG, WCH, WC etc.
    Thanks in advance.

    It's a bit difficult...she played in NT until 2001, then in 2002 when WCH was in Germany she didn't play because of a knee injury. There was a some bad talk about her, people saying she could have played if she really wanted, and after that she didn't want to play for NT any more. In 2008 Guidetti convinced her because he once was her coach in Italy, and at that time she said the reason she didn't play in NT so long was that she was scared that people would talk bad again if she didn't play as good as they expect. In the first match in OGQ 2008 she had tears in her eyes because it was such a strong emotion to play in NT once again.
